WebDec 20, 2024 · Traditional Bulgarian dishes for Christmas Eve celebration It is common to set apart a plate full of food during the feast. After dinner, the table is not cleaned up but is left with the food overnight as well. The traditional belief is that Saint Mary and the ancestors’ spirits visit the house before Christmas morning. WebDec 15, 2024 · Christmas in Bulgaria is celebrated in a unique way, in accordance with the Eastern Orthodox Church’s traditions. The first Christmas custom is held on St. Ignatius Day, which is celebrated on December 20. According to folk traditions, whoever first enters your house on this day will shape the nature of the upcoming new year.
